This skill manages both high-level objectives and actionable tasks through Hivemind's goal system, replacing the legacy tasks CLI. It creates and tracks goals, KPIs, and work items when users mention targets, milestones, or specific actions like "fix X" or "remind me to." Developers should use its dedicated tools (like `hivemind_goal_add`) instead of interacting with the host filesystem directly.

Hivemind Goals (openclaw)
OpenClaw exposes purpose-built tools for goals + KPIs. Use them directly — do NOT try to write files via the host filesystem.
Tools
hivemind_goal_add({ text })— create a new goal. Returnsgoal_id(UUID). Status starts atopened.hivemind_kpi_add({ goal_id, kpi_id, target, unit, name? })— add a KPI to an existing goal. Only call when the user explicitly asks for KPIs; do NOT auto-generate.hivemind_search({ query })— search Hivemind shared memory (summaries + sessions). Use this when the user asks "what's already there" before creating a duplicate.hivemind_read({ path })— read the full content of a specific Hivemind path.hivemind_index({})— list everything in memory.
Workflow when the user expresses a goal
- (Optional)
hivemind_searchfirst to surface any existing related goal. hivemind_goal_add({ text: "<short description>" })— capture the returnedgoal_id.- ONLY if the user asks for KPIs:
hivemind_kpi_addonce per KPI withgoal_id+kpi_id(short slug likek-prs) +target(positive int) +unit. - Confirm to the user with the goal_id and that the goal is team-visible.
Capture a task for later (with resumable context)
When the user parks a tangential task mid-session — "save this for later", "remind me to …", "don't let me forget …", "let's do X later" — store enough context to resume cold later, not just a one-liner. Put the full package in the text of hivemind_goal_add:
hivemind_goal_add({ text:
"Add rate-limiting to the webhook handler\n\n" +
"Start here: add a per-IP token bucket on the handler entry path\n" +
"Files: src/webhook/handler.ts:120-160, src/webhook/limits.ts\n" +
"Branch: feat/webhook-hardening\n" +
"Run: pnpm test webhook\n" +
"Why: bursty clients hammer the endpoint; defer until retry-backoff lands" })
Line 1 is the label. Fill Start here / Files / Branch / Run / Why from the conversation; Start here: (the concrete first action) matters most. (OpenClaw's hivemind_goal_add has no provenance flag, so the row is tagged manual — that's fine; the context is what matters.)
Resume a parked task (automatic context transfer)
When the user says "let's work on that task / goal" or "pick up the <X> task":
hivemind_search({ query: "<topic>" })orhivemind_index({})to locate the parked goal, thenhivemind_read({ path: "memory/goal/<owner>/opened/<goal_id>.md" })to pull the full context package back.- Read it as your working context and begin from
Start here:using theFiles/Branch/Runlines — continue as if the context was never lost.
(Status-move tools aren't exposed on OpenClaw, so leave the goal where it is and just resume the work.)
What NOT to do
- Do NOT write files anywhere under
~/.deeplake/memory/. OpenClaw's runtime does not route filesystem writes to the Deeplake tables — only thehivemind_*tools above do. - Do NOT call
hivemind_kpi_addunsolicited. Wait for the user to ask. - Do NOT use
hivemind_searchto create anything — it's read-only.
